Frequently Asked Questions about Bronx

How much are Studio apartments in Bronx?

There are currently 8,923 Studio Apartments in Bronx with rent ranges from $1,039 to $7,403 with an average price of $2,640.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Bronx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Bronx ranges from $1,200 to $7,810 with an average monthly rent of $3,051.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Bronx c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Bronx range from $1,757 to $11,820.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,899.

How expensive are Bronx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 2,541 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Bronx on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,150 to $13,995 - averaging $4,297 for the location.
